The discussion revolves around determining why the line y=2x-5 is tangent to the circle defined by (x-7)²+(y+1)²=20. The circle's center is at (7,-1) with a radius of approximately 4.47. Participants emphasize the importance of calculating the distance from the circle's center to the line using the correct formula, which involves ensuring proper signs and values for a, b, c, d, and e. The method to confirm tangency is to check if this distance equals the radius. If not, you could approach the problem by trying to find where the line intersects the circle. There are three possibilities: (1) the line intersects the circle in two distinct points (2) the line intersects the circle at only one point (3) the line doesn't intersect the circle at all.

To find where the line intersects the circle, you solve the circle and line equations simultaneously. The line equation says y = 2x-5. You could substitute this expression for y into the circle equation and try to solve the resulting equation for x.
